8.1 Setting Clear SEO Goals

Setting clear SEO goals is essential for the success of your blog. Without specific goals in mind, it can be challenging to measure the effectiveness of your SEO efforts and track your progress. Here are some key steps to help you set clear SEO goals:

  1. Define Your Objectives: Start by defining what you want to achieve with your blog’s SEO. Do you want to increase organic traffic, improve keyword rankings, or enhance user engagement? Clearly outline your objectives to provide direction for your SEO strategy.
  2. Set Measurable Targets: Make sure your goals are measurable so that you can track your performance over time. For example, aim to increase organic traffic by 20% within the next three months or improve your blog’s search ranking for specific keywords.
  3. Establish a Timeline: Set realistic timelines for achieving your SEO goals. Breaking down your goals into smaller, manageable tasks with deadlines can help you stay on track and make steady progress towards your objectives.
  4. Monitor and Adjust: Regularly monitor your SEO performance using tools like Google Analytics and Search Console. Analyze the data to see if you are on track to meet your goals and make adjustments to your strategy as needed.
  5. Celebrate Milestones: Acknowledge and celebrate your achievements along the way. Whether it’s reaching a certain traffic milestone or improving your blog’s visibility in search results, recognizing your progress can help keep you motivated and focused on your SEO goals.

By setting clear SEO goals, you can create a roadmap for your blog’s SEO strategy and work towards improving your search engine visibility and rankings. Remember, consistency and persistence are key to achieving long-term success in SEO.
